About this app

• Know the battery and charging status of your devices, from a single place, even if they are miles away

• See their battery history

• Get notified when the batteries are getting low, or are about to finish charging

• See statistics for your batteries, including cycles and calibration count

• Be warned when damaging usage patterns are detected

Cross-platform: Clouttery is also available for Windows and Chrome, and has a website. In all of these, you can see the status of your batteries and receive notifications.

Fine notification control: You can select for what devices you want to get notifications, and in the website you can even adjust the types of notifications to see for each device.

To be useful, this app must be paired with a Clouttery account, which is free. Head over to http://clouttery.xyz for more information. Clouttery is a subscription service that is currently in Beta; users who sign-up during the Beta period will get Clouttery for free, forever.

This app uses a negligible amount of power, and by default doesn't use mobile data to sync in the background. You can change this in the settings.

Clouttery is constantly being improved, and clients for more platforms and more features are in development.
